Why Choose Double Glazed Windows Near Me?

Double glazing can significantly reduce your energy costs and improve the comfort of your home and increase the value of your home. It can also help reduce the sound from outside and also between rooms.

The gap between the windows is filled with an insulating gas, such as argon, krypton or even xenon. These gases are more efficient than air in cutting down on heat transfer.

Energy Efficiency

New windows can be very effective in stopping cold air coming into the home and keeping the heat. This will help save energy costs because it reduces the need to use your heating system and keep changing your thermostat to keep your house warm enough. The amount you save will be contingent on the type of windows and the quality of the installation. It is also contingent on the extent to which your old windows insulated your home, if they created drafts, and how efficient they were.

Double glazed windows are a fantastic choice for those looking to improve the energy efficiency of their property. The insulation gap between two panes stops heat loss and keeps out cold air. This will save you money on your energy bill and reduce carbon emissions.

Gases like argon can be used to fill the gaps between double-glazed windows. It is an inert, non-toxic and odourless gas that helps to prevent thermal transfer. This allows the window to perform better than single-paned windows. They can also be filled with Krypton or Xenon which are more expensive, but provide better performance.

Reduced Noise

Noise pollution outside your home may affect your health. This is particularly relevant if you live close to a busy road or airport. Double-glazed windows can help to reduce the noise, so you can have more restful sleep and have a more peaceful home.

They don't allow the same amount of sound through as single-glazed windows. They're made up of two panes that are separated by inert gases and sound waves have to travel through the layers before reaching you. This drastically reduces the amount of sound that can get into your house and can make a significant difference in how you live.

This is due to the gap between the two panes glass allows for some sounds to travel through. You can improve the sound insulation by adding laminated glass to your double-glazed windows or opting for the greater gap. The kind of gas used between the panes will influence the reduction in sound.
